Incorrect. When balancing a game the developers do not assume that any one other factor is in place, as this will eventually lead to the creation or development of situational Demigods; Demigods that only really excel when a certain criteria has been met, such as the presence of another Demigod. For a real world example of this, please refer to DotA, which based several items and Heroes around situations; several of these are now the least selected items and Heroes in the game.
